Family Liaisons

Our goal is to create welcoming environments to engage all families in becoming authentic co-owners of our schools who share the responsibility for each student to become college, career, and life ready.

Through relationship building and building staff and parent capacity, we create opportunities for family participation in learning, leadership, and advocacy that result in high levels of academic achievement and life opportunities for individual students and the entire school.

Our School Division also has Family Liaisons in many of our schools, including language-specific Family Liaisons who serve the needs of Arabic-, Amharic-, Dari/Farsi- and Spanish-speaking families division-wide. These school staff members work as connectors between home and school.

What are Family Liaisons?

Family Liaisons are responsible for developing relationships with families that foster trust between families and the school to support students’ successful academic and social-emotional development.

How can a Family Liaison help me?

Family Liaisons work to bridge communication between school and home by connecting parents/caregivers to the educational information, tools and support they need to ensure their child's academic success and healthy social-emotional development at home. They work towards our goal of engaging families to be equal partners with our schools in supporting the success of all students.

Supports include:

  • Assisting families in navigating the school system
  • Connecting families with school personnel (teachers, social workers, special education, etc.)
  • Developing educational opportunities for families (math and literacy workshops)
  • Parent Orientation Meetings
  • Connecting families with volunteer opportunities
  • Addressing any issues and concerns you may have at the school
  • Connecting you and your family with educational opportunities to support your child at home
  • Facilitating parent meetings, workshops, and leadership development in collaboration with teachers
